What are the main challenges a List Manager faces in maintaining data accuracy and compliance?

A List Manager often encounters challenges such as ensuring data accuracy, keeping lists up to date, and complying with privacy regulations like GDPR and CAN-SPAM. This requires regular audits, deduplication, and verification of contact information. Additionally, List Managers must collaborate closely with marketing, sales, and IT teams to implement best practices and safeguard sensitive data. Staying informed about evolving compliance requirements and leveraging the right tools can help mitigate these challenges and ensure effective list management.

The List Manager primarily focuses on organizing and maintaining contact lists for marketing and outreach efforts, often working with CRM systems. Data Analysts interpret complex data sets to provide actionable insights across various industries. While both roles involve data handling, List Managers concentrate on list quality and segmentation, whereas Data Analysts focus on data analysis and reporting.

What is a List Manager?

A List Manager is a professional responsible for maintaining, organizing, and updating lists of contacts or data, often for marketing, communication, or operational purposes. They ensure that the information is accurate, up-to-date, and compliant with relevant privacy regulations. List Managers may also segment lists for targeted campaigns, remove duplicates, and manage subscription preferences. This role is crucial for organizations that rely on accurate data for effective outreach and customer relationship management.
